PM Modi’s meditation completed after three days: Sadhana in Kanyakumari for 45 hours

PM Modi’s meditation completed after three days meditation, PM Modi was meditating at the Vivekananda Rock Memorial in Kanyakumari for the last 45 hours. He remained in Dhyana Mandapam for three days. The special thing about this Dhyana Mandapam is that this is the same place where Swami Vivekananda meditated for three days after touring the country. It was here that he dreamed of a developed India. It is believed that Goddess Parvati had meditated at this place by standing on one leg.

The second day of meditation started with PM Modi offering Arghya to the Sun at sunrise. A video of PM Modi’s meditation also surfaced, in the video PM Modi was in saffron kurta and gamchha. Yesterday he meditated sitting in front of the statue of Swami Vivekananda. He had a rosary in his hands and the sound of Om was resonating.


PM Modi reached Kanyakumari on Thursday. The Prime Minister was seen in the traditional attire of South India wearing a dhoti. He was wearing an off-white colored shawl. After reaching Kanyakumari, offered prayers and puja at Bhagwati Amman temple. Let us tell you, after the end of the general election campaign, PM Modi goes on a spiritual journey every time and after the 2019 election campaign, he went to Kedarnath and in the year 2014, he went to Pratapgarh related to Shivaji Maharaj.

During his visit to India, Vivekananda had closely known the sufferings, pain, poverty, self-respect and lack of education of the common people. Vivekananda reached the rock located about 500 meters away from the beach by swimming on 24 December 1892. He meditated on this rock from 25 to 27 December. He dreamed of a developed India for the future of India here.  This is the same place where he had darshan of Mother India. It was at this place that he dreamed of devoting the rest of his life to the people.

There was a long struggle to build the Vivekananda Memorial on the Vivekananda Rock. Eknath Ranade played a big role in this.
